Abstract
This study estimate radiation biological danger factor by measuring patient's exposed dose and propose the low way of patient's exposed dose in panoramic radiography. We seek correcting constant of OSL dosimeter for minimize the error of exposed dose's measurement and measure the Left, Right crystalline lens, thyroid, directly included upper, lower lips, the maxillary bone and the center of photographing that indirect included in panoramic radiography by using the human body model standard phantom advised in ICRP. In result, the center of photographing's level of radiation maximum value is $413.67{\pm}6.53{\mu}Gy$ and each upper, lower lips is $217.80{\pm}2.98{\mu}Gy$, $215.33{\pm}2.61{\mu}Gy$. Also in panoramic radiography, indirect included Left, Right crystalline lens's level of radiation are $30.73{\pm}2.34{\mu}Gy$, $31.87{\pm}2.50{\mu}Gy$, and thyroid's level of measured exposed dose can cause effect of radiation biological and we need justifiable analysis about radiation defense rule and substantiation advised international organization for the low way of patient's exposed dose in panoramic radiography of dental clinic and we judge need the additional study about radiation defense organization for protect the systematize protocol's finance and around internal organs for minimize until accepted by many people that is technological, economical and social fact by using panoramic measurement.
